Make a Difference: Lead Our Homeshare Program in South Australia
The St Vincent de Paul Society (SA) Inc is a major international charitable and voluntary organisation that has been operating in South Australia since 1884. Our principal role is to provide for, or alleviate, the needs of disadvantaged people in the community.
As the Homeshare Coordinator, you will play a pivotal role in spearheading the expansion of our program while exemplifying our core values. Your primary objective is to implement, develop, promote, and oversee the Homeshare initiative, ensuring its continual success and establishing a resilient framework for sustained operation well into the future. Your pivotal role revolves around fostering enduring connections and facilitating thriving living arrangements within our community.
Recruit, interview, and assess potential Householders and Homesharers, ensuring compatibility and suitability for the program.
The successful candidate will report to the Community Services Manager.
We are seeking an individual with outstanding interpersonal skills, genuine compassion, and extensive experience in community service program delivery, particularly within the realm of housing and support services. They must exhibit unwavering dedication to Vinnies mission and values, actively championing its core principles while steadfastly ensuring the well-being of all program participants.
Applicants must hold a bachelor’s degree in social work, social sciences, health, or a related field, along with at least 3-5 years of experience in community service program development and delivery.
A current (Class C) Driver's License is required, and some out-of-hours work will be required. Employment is contingent upon satisfactory National Police Checks and Medical Assessments.
